]]></content:encoded></item><item>	<title>The 'Headline News' Cup Sleeve</title>	<link>http://www.creativereview.co.uk/feed/may-2012/15/the-headline-news-cup-sleeve</link>	<comments>http://www.creativereview.co.uk/feed/may-2012/15/the-headline-news-cup-sleeve#feedback</comments>	<pubDate>Tue, 15 May 2012 03:27:00 +0000</pubDate>	<dc:creator>wmathovani</dc:creator>	<category><![CDATA[Advertising]]></category>	<guid isPermaLink="false">http://www.creativereview.co.uk/index.php?page_id=49866</guid>	<description><![CDATA[<p>The 'Headline News' Cup Sleeve</p><p><img src="http://www.creativereview.co.uk/images/2012/05/headline_news_cup_sleeve_direct_cr_0.jpg" width="569" height="402" alt="" /></p>]]></description>	<content:encoded><![CDATA[<img src="http://www.creativereview.co.uk/images/2012/05/headline_news_cup_sleeve_direct_cr_0.jpg" width="569" height="402" alt="" /><br />Gulf News, the UAE's leading English daily newspaper, wanted to reach even more readers and convert them into subscribers.

Consumption habit suggests that people read newspapers while having their morning cup of coffee. So since fresh news goes well with fresh coffee, we adapted the coffee cup sleeve of Tim Hortons, a global coffee chain, into an advertising medium and we created The ‘Headline News’ Cup Sleeve. 

Every cup. Every hour. Every day. When Tim Hortons customers received a cup of coffee, they also received the headline news of the hour, printed using a special printer that pulled out tweets from the Gulf News Twitter account. The short URL and QR code on the sleeve then directed them to the Gulf News website where they could read the full story.

THE RESULTS
• Until now, over 1,440 headline tweets have been printed on more than 840,000 coffee cups.
• More than 2,900 new Gulf News Twitter followers in the first two weeks of the campaign launch.
• The traffic on the Gulf News website grew by 41%.
• Subscription’s up by 2.8% so far. 
• We’re rolling out this project in Tim Hortons outlets across the UAE and in 14 new outlets soon to be opened.

Check out the online version at http://issuu.com/jabradley/docs/manifesto_of_jamesbradley]]></content:encoded></item><item>	<title>The Bloody Chamber</title>	<link>http://www.creativereview.co.uk/feed/may-2012/13/the-bloody-chamber</link>	<comments>http://www.creativereview.co.uk/feed/may-2012/13/the-bloody-chamber#feedback</comments>	<pubDate>Sun, 13 May 2012 13:23:00 +0000</pubDate>	<dc:creator>hannahillustration</dc:creator>	<category><![CDATA[Illustration]]></category>	<guid isPermaLink="false">http://www.creativereview.co.uk/index.php?page_id=49819</guid>	<description><![CDATA[<p>The Bloody Chamber</p><p><img src="http://www.creativereview.co.uk/images/2012/05/i_thebloodychamberhannahlewis_0.jpg" width="569" height="838" alt="" /></p>]]></description>	<content:encoded><![CDATA[<img src="http://www.creativereview.co.uk/images/2012/05/i_thebloodychamberhannahlewis_0.jpg" width="569" height="838" alt="" /><br />This was my entry for the Competition set by the Folio Society and House of Illustration.
The brief was to illustrate three stories from The Bloody Chamber and to design the binding.
 
The stories in the book are dark and layered with symbolism, red is a significant colour theme throughout each story representing the ruby necklace, blood and the colour of Puss’s fur – I used black and white as a base for the red to stand out. Each story comments on the empowerment of female sexuality and so I wanted the females to take the lead in each image.
I was limited to depicting only three of the stories from the book so I wanted the Binding to be an amalgamation of them all with a key object from each story in white appearing buried on a background of black soil.]]></content:encoded></item><item>	<title>Victoria Packaging: Logo</title>	<link>http://www.creativereview.co.uk/feed/may-2012/11/victoria-packaging-logo</link>	<comments>http://www.creativereview.co.uk/feed/may-2012/11/victoria-packaging-logo#feedback</comments>	<pubDate>Fri, 11 May 2012 13:14:00 +0000</pubDate>	<dc:creator>Jolanta Zute</dc:creator>	<category><![CDATA[Graphic Design]]></category><category><![CDATA[Type / Typography]]></category>	<guid isPermaLink="false">http://www.creativereview.co.uk/index.php?page_id=49804</guid>	<description><![CDATA[<p>Victoria Packaging: Logo</p><p><img src="http://www.creativereview.co.uk/images/2012/05/victoria_packaging_design_0.jpg" width="569" height="243" alt="" /></p>]]></description>	<content:encoded><![CDATA[<img src="http://www.creativereview.co.uk/images/2012/05/victoria_packaging_design_0.jpg" width="569" height="243" alt="" /><br />Logo design for a packaging company called Victoria Packaging.
